About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Develop machine learning, deep learning, statistical, and physics-based models using time-series sensor data, machine fault codes, inspections, and analysis records
  • Identify health anomalies, predict equipment failure modes, estimate remaining useful life, and build equipment risk models
  • Evaluate emerging technologies, product services, and technology platforms
  • Develop and implement Generative AI solutions, including model training, evaluation, selection, prompt engineering, agents, assistants, and chatbots
  • Perform reliability monitoring, observability, incident response, automation development, reliability analysis, operational readiness reviews, root-cause investigations, performance optimization, and continuous improvement
  • Plan and execute global telematics device programs, including testing and analysis of cellular, satellite,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, and other technologies
  • Provide digital technical support for Caterpillar digital applications and products
  • Partner with experienced engineers and data scientists to build AI and analytics solutions for fleet management, equipment failure prediction, and operational optimization

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or’s degree or higher in data science, computer engineering, electrical engineering or related degree; selected candidates must complete their degree by their start date
  • 0-2 years of relevant experience related to this field; internships or academic projects are a plus
  • Minimum cumulative GPA requirement 3.0/4.0 (no rounding)
  • Knowledge of statistical tools, processes, and practices for business decision-making
  • Accuracy and attention to detail
  • Analytical thinking and root-cause analysis
  • Knowledge of machine learning principles, technologies, and algorithms
  • Programming language knowledge and ability to write and modify code
  • Knowledge of data management systems and query/database access tools
  • Requirements analysis skills
  • Sponsorship now or in the future is NOT available for this position
  • Successful completion of a drug screen required
